Handover note — Crumbwheel order cutoffs.

Welcome aboard. The bakery cutoff rule in Crumbwheel closes same-day orders at 14:00 local to each storefront, not UTC — this has bitten us twice. Holiday overrides live in the calendar service and take precedence silently, so always check there first when a cutoff looks wrong. To unlock the calendar service's admin console after a restart, enter the recovery passphrase below.

vault phrase of bagap-bahaf = silion-pelox-sorox-casdor-quenwyn-fraax-eliox-praael-kelion-quenvan-kasox-rusael-norius-belvan

Handover: Stagemap renderer

Taking over from me on the Pemberly Theatre seat-map renderer. Current state: zoom and row-labelling stable; accessibility overlay still flaky on balcony tiers — known issue, ticket filed. Rendering falls back to static SVG if the canvas layer fails; don't disable that. Release is gated on the pricing-band colour fix, already merged, just needs a tag. Cache invalidation runs nightly; don't change the schedule mid-season. The render service must be started with the following configuration values.

deployment values, faduf-tawep:
SORDOR_LOG_LEVEL=error
SORDOR_METRICS_HOST=metrics.sordor.nelvrolabs.internal
SORDOR_POOL_SIZE=4

Release checklist: the Tollgate payments service still has three flaky integration tests around refund retries. They pass locally but fail intermittently on the shared runner, so we've quarantined them for this release and filed follow-ups. Do not block the cut on these. Before signing off, verify the quarantined suite against the candidate build referenced below.

trace token, fafog-kageg: htk4_98e6